Book Description Description: Rally O is the fastest growing dog sport in America! Using quick, easy, positive methods with a clicker and food rewards, Dennison explains how you can train your own dog to excel in Rally. Dennison is a certified member of APDT. She trains at her facility in New England and has been competing in various events with her Border Collies and Shelties since 1996.
